Earl is ordering supplies. Yellow paper costs $4.00 per ream while white paper costs $7.50 per ream. He would like to order 100
Eddi Din [679]

Answer:

Earl should order 76 yellow paper reams and 24 white paper reams.

Step-by-step explanation:

This problem can be computed as system of equations.

I will say that x is the number of yellow paper reams and that y is the number of white paper reams.

Earl will order 100 reams in total, so

x + y = 100

He has a budget of $484, so this is what he is going to spend. Each yellow paper ream(x) costs $4.00 and each white paper ream costs $7.50, so we know that

4x + 7.5y = 484

To know how many reams of each color should he order, we need to solve the following system of equations

1) x + y = 100

2) 4x + 7.5y = 484

I am going to write x as a function of y in equation 1), and then replace it in equation 2).

x = 100-y

Now replacing in equation 2)

4(100-y) + 7.5y = 484

400 - 4y + 7.5y = 484

3.5y = 84

y = 24.

Returning to equation 1)

x = 100-y = 100-24 = 76

So, Earl should order 76 yellow paper reams and 24 white paper reams.

Shana is climbing a mountain at a constant pace. She rises in elevation by 17.5 feet per minute. After hiking for 30 minutes, a
Mnenie [13.5K]

Answer:

The linear equation for Shana's elevation is E = 17.5\cdot t+1640.

Step-by-step explanation:

According to the statement, we find that Shana is climbing at constant rate in time and height as a function of time can be represented by linear function:

E = h_{o}+\dot h\cdot t (Eq. 1)

Where:

h_{o} - Initial height above sea level, measured in feet.

E - Elevation above sea level, measured in feet.

\dot h - Climbing rate, measured in feet per minute.

t - Time, measured in minutes.

If we know that E = 2165\,ft, \dot h = 17.5\,\frac{ft}{min} and t = 30\,s. the initial height above sea level is:

h_{o} = E - \dot h\cdot t

h_{o} = 2165\,ft-\left(17.5\,\frac{ft}{min} \right)\cdot (30\,min)

h_{o} = 1640\,ft

The linear equation for Shana's elevation is E = 17.5\cdot t+1640.
